HTML结构方面
<!--父元素-->
<div class="seller" ref="seller">
<!--需要出现滚动条的内容区-->
<div class="content"></div>
</div>
样式方面
对父元素seller必须有一定的高度而且必须出现隐藏滚动条,这样一旦子元素content的高度高过父元素的时候就会出现滚动条,否则不会出现
.seller
position: absolute
top: 174px
bottom: 0
left: 0
width: 100%
overflow hidden
JavaScript方面
if (!this.scroll) {
this.scroll = new BScroll(this.$refs.seller, {
click: true
});
} else {
this.scroll.refresh();
}
总结:用一个if...else这样就避免了一直重复的去计算this.scroll 了
**粗体** _斜体_ [链接](http://example.com) `代码` - 列表 > 引用
。你还可以使用@
来通知其他用户。